I did look at “Observation” which is actually the former Rocket Jets ride on top of the former PeopleMover/Rocket Rods station. For people that don’t know it, it is a satellite-theme sculpture that came to life every fifteen minutes and plays a song while moving. I really do miss the old Rocket Jets & PeopleMover/Rocket Rods (I didn’t care much about Rocket Rods back then which had ridiculous wait times and broke down a lot). It would be nice if they do something about the former PeopleMover/Rocket Rods station and bring something back since it is just a waste to see the station not being used for something. It has been over 10 years since they used that station and counting.
